Research On The Design And Application Of Smart Classroom Teaching Mode To Promote Deep Learning Of College Students

Deep learning is an important concept put forward by contemporary learning science.It is learning with the purpose of mastering learning methods,improving practical ability,and cultivating higher-order thinking.The development of the information society has caused great changes in the way of learning and thinking of college students.Deep learning is an effective way of learning,and its training goals also propose clear expectations for classroom teaching in colleges and universities.How to promote the effective occurrence of in-depth learning of college students in actual teaching,and to cultivate the necessary characters and key abilities that college students need for their development in modern society and in the future is an urgent problem that higher education needs to solve.Passive learning and single evaluation in traditional classrooms hinder the development of deep learning for college students.Under the current trend of in-depth integration of information technology and teaching,how to use information technology to promote deep learning of college students has become a hot spot in education research.The proposal and development of smart classrooms is the inevitable result of school education informatization focusing on teaching,focusing on classrooms,and focusing on teacher-student activities.Therefore,this research takes the opportunity to use smart classrooms and the concept of reverse teaching as the top-level guidance method to design a new teaching model to promote the occurrence of deep learning results of college students,thereby improving students' deep learning skills such as learning independently,working together,solving problems,transferring and applying,and critical thinking.This research is mainly carried out from the following aspects:(1)Preliminary analysis: Through reading a large number of documents and national policy documents,the first part explores the current research status of deep learning and smart classrooms at home and abroad,in addition,deep learning and shallow learning smart classroom and traditional classroom are analyzed and compared.This part sorts out and summarizes the conceptual features of deep learning and smart classrooms,and then analyzes the relevant teaching theory basis.The theoretical foundation is expected to bring enlightenment to the construction of a smart classroom teaching model that promotes deep learning for college students.(2)Design teaching mode: First of all,reverse instructional design concept is determined as the top-level guiding method of instructional design mode,and its connotation and specific operating steps are further elaborated.Then,principles of constructing teaching mode are designed according to the connotation characteristics of deep learning and intelligent classroom.Finally,teaching concepts and design principles are adopted.The teaching performance evaluation evidence and evaluation standards is based on designing the expression method and classification method of teaching objectives in turn,finally,it constructs the smart classroom teaching mode that promotes the deep learning of college students.(3)Apply teaching models and analyze practical effects: According to the questionnaire analysis and preliminary survey,the comparison class and experimental class were selected to apply the designed teaching mode in the experimental research of the course Computer Network Basis.The results,questionnaire analysis and interview analysis,were combined to test the effect of the smart classroom teaching mode promoting college students' deep learning.
